Winning is always nice, but doing so behind a season-high score is even better (just ask Greenfield). They were the clear victors by a 57-34 margin over the Fulton County Pilots on Friday. The Yellowjackets have seen this before: they got the W the last time they saw the Pilots, too.

Greenfield's win was the result of several impressive offensive performances. One of the most notable came from Easton Sullivan, who rushed for 97 yards and a pair of touchdowns on only eight carries, and also threw for 199 yards and three TDs while completing 83.3% of his passes. A healthy portion of Sullivan's aerial production (102 yards to be exact) went to Westin Porter.

Fulton County's loss came despite a true team effort from the offense with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Preston Smith, who threw for 205 yards and three TDs, and also rushed for 31 yards and one score. Davarius Freeman was another key player, rushing for 91 yards and one touchdown on only eight carries.

Greenfield picked up their first home win, bumping their record up to 2-3. As for Fulton County, they are on a ten-game losing streak (dating back to last season) that has dropped them down to 0-5.

Both teams will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Greenfield will venture away from home to face off against West Carroll at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. The Yellowjackets will be up against the War Eagles' rather soft defense (which has allowed 39 points per matchup), so fans could be in store for a big offensive performance.
